Franz Ficker

Summary

Franz Ficker is a human[1]. Born in Nebovazy[2], he… he was born on February 25, 1782[3]. He died in Vienna[4]. He died on April 22, 1849[5]. He worked as an aesthetician[6], philologist[7], and literary historian[8].
